Translation files not working
January 13, 2009, 04:57:54 am
Hi,

I've been working on translations and after several hours translating to pt_PT at Pootle, I've downloaded the files, uploaded them to the server l10n/pt_PT/LC_MESSAGES, checked back at the civiCRM Admin configurations, selected the Portuguese (pt_PT) default, configured all items, logged out Joomla Admin and logged back in and the civiCRM translations I've made aren't active.  :S  I currently get the old uncomplete translation without the changes I've made.
Checked back the .po file in the folder and all translated items are there but not displaying.

Another issue is that in the front-end, for instance when the user submits his profile update (using civiCRM form) the message comes in English, despite the user preferences being in other language like Portuguese.
I've been fishing around to see where these messages are located and can't find them. Any help here would be also appreciated.

Thanks!

Re: Translation files not working
January 13, 2009, 05:19:56 am
Mario,

In order to have your translated strings display, you need to compile .po file to .mo format. Please check other threads on this forum, it was discussed a couple of times, for example here:
http://forum.civicrm.org/index.php/topic,5792.0.html

If it comes to profile information, please check if the text is translated in PO, if it's a system message, or is it translated in the database, if it's a part of profile configuration (civicrm/admin/uf/group).

Yikes! It's working now. I had to get the Poedit for mac and start translating and uploading to the LC_MESSAGES folder. Now the issues with the front end messages have gone also and all, related to this is working fine.
